Hi,
one of my users tried to register into our Kallithea server. His last
name contains a non ASCII character (é, i.e. an accented e). This
resulted in the following error (which I have redacted a bit to avoid
leaking personal info). The relevant part seems to be the
"('lastname', 'Jim\xc3\xa9nez')".
Module kallithea.model.user:199 in create_registration
<< '- Full Name: {user.full_name}\n'
'- Email: {user.email}\n'
).format(user=new_user)
edit_url = h.canonical_url('edit_user', id=new_user.user_id)
email_kwargs = {
).format(user=new_user)
UnicodeEncodeError: 'ascii' codec can't encode character u'\xe9' in
position 9: ordinal not in range(128)
That is on the stable branch? I think I solved that on the default
branch in
https://kallithea-scm.org/repos/kallithea/changeset/330c671dd451#kallitheamodeluserpy_o194
. Can you test and confirm that? Then I will put just that part of the
change on the stable branch.
